mikediamond Coin Collector. In a broadstrike, all design elements are present on both faces. In order to diagnose an off-center strike, the design has to be cut off along the edge on at least one face. Wide AM and Close AM Lincoln Varieties. So, what exactly is a Wide AM and Close AM Cent?The terms Close AM and Wide AM refer to the spacing between the letters ‘A’ and ‘M’ in “America” on the reverse of the Lincoln Memorial Cent.

1992 saw a major drop in production for both the Philadelphia Mint and Denver Mint as well. With combined production of just over 770 million quarters, it would be easy to assume there would be some increase in value. Not true. 1992 Washington quarters still only hold "common" value, with values for those in MS-63 or higher holding value with clad quarters from other years.

Free shipping for many products!The double-struck coin typically will be struck correctly on the first strike, but then will be struck again either on-center or off-center. A double-struck coin is one that has just been struck twice, but the number of times a coin can be struck is infinite, and some coins are known with over 100 strikes on them.Christian Houle, Guide to Errors and Varieties on Canadian Coins. If you find a special coin made from silver, or with a unique mint of origin error, the value of your coin can skyrocket.In 2021, a red toned 1990 penny minted in Denver sold for just under $3,000 on eBay. A year later, another red 1990 penny graded MS68 was sold by coin specialists Heritage Auctions for just $57. The difference is rarity. The MS68 specimen was one of 253 graded at the same level by the PCGS.
